Common use of Third-Party Architecture Clause in Contracts

Third-Party Architecture. Braze may use one or more third-party content delivery networks to provide the Braze Services and to optimize content delivery via the Braze Services. Content items to be served to subscribers or end-users, such as images or attachments uploaded to the Braze Services, may be cached with such content delivery networks to expedite transmission. Information transmitted across a content delivery network may be accessed by that content delivery network solely to enable these functions.
